Let’s talk about the for Heat the Soul 7 and why you need to play it. Why Heat the Soul 7 Specifically? While earlier games were fun, HTS 7 is the ultimate package. Released in 2011, it covers the Arrancar: Downfall arc and the beginning of the Lost Substitute Shinigami arc (Fullbringers).
